Understanding Thai Kratom Powder: Origins and Varieties
Thai Kratom Powder, known for its potent effects and unique profiles, has a rich history deeply rooted in Thailand’s cultural landscape. This traditional herb, scientifically known as Mitragyna speciosa, thrives in the lush tropical forests of Southeast Asia. Thai kratom is celebrated for its diversity, with various strains offering distinct experiences ranging from energizing to relaxing. The origins of these varieties are tied to specific regions within Thailand, each with unique environmental factors contributing to subtle differences in chemical composition.

Safety Considerations and Responsible Use Guidelines
Kratom, a natural substance derived from the leaves of the Mitragyna speciosa plant, has gained popularity for its potential therapeutic effects. However, it’s crucial to approach its use with caution and adhere to responsible guidelines. Safety considerations are paramount when dealing with any substance, and kratom is no exception. While generally considered safe in moderate doses, long-term or excessive use may lead to adverse effects, including skin discoloration, digestive issues, and potential addiction.
Responsible use involves starting with low dosages, gradually increasing as needed, and never exceeding recommended limits. It’s essential to consult healthcare professionals, especially those with pre-existing conditions or taking other medications. Regular breaks from kratom use are advised to prevent tolerance buildup. Additionally, staying informed about local laws and regulations regarding kratom is vital to avoid any legal complications associated with its possession and usage.
